On Thu, 19 Jan 2006 [email protected] wrote: > Agree that a level of security is required, but the real value is in > customers like banks knowing where their fiber is, so when they lease > service for a back up provider they know it is not in the same ditch. Does the bank actually need that information? Or does there need to be a way for the two providers to do conflict detection between their design layout groups? You don't need copies of all provider's fiber maps to do conflict detection for a particular group of circuits.
